Handing off the image-slimming work on Crateline. Base images moved from full OS to the minimal runtime variant; savings ~60%. Remaining fat: the reporting service still bundles build toolchains — multi-stage its Dockerfile next. Rules: no shell in prod images, pin digests, run the size-check CI gate before merge. Don't touch the batch-runner image until its cron migration lands. Current sizes, targets, and the exemption list are tracked on the internal page below.

wiki page, tahaf-tajog: https://jira.ordindyn.corp/pipeline

**Q: How does the KioskGuard watchdog recover from a hung session?**

KioskGuard pings the Lumabox kiosk shell every five seconds. After three missed heartbeats it kills the shell process, clears volatile session state, and relaunches in attract mode. Crash dumps are written to an encrypted local partition and rotated after seven days. The watchdog itself runs as a separate hardened service and cannot be disabled from the kiosk UI. To unlock the dump partition during an audit, use the passphrase below.

recovery phrase for kahof-kahif: ulaix-zorox

Ticket — missed pick-up, bay 2. Hey, the courier never showed yesterday for the spare parts headed to the Skarro pump station. Two pallets of valve assemblies and seal kits are still sitting by the dock doors, and the site crew out there is getting twitchy since their backup pump is down. I've rebooked the run for tomorrow morning, first slot. Can you make sure someone's on the dock and the paperwork is ready to go? The hand-over instruction for the courier is right below this.

courier memo of yawep-yafog: the pramir ulaix courier leaves the ulavan aldix frair zorok oliiel joreth rusdor fenvan ledger at gate 1305 under passcode 514738

## Upgrade Quillbus broker to 4.x

This PR bumps the Quillbus message broker from 3.9 to 4.2 across the Fernhollow staging cluster. The new version changes default heartbeat behavior, so I've pinned explicit values rather than relying on upstream defaults. Consumer groups were re-tested against the orders and invoicing topics with no message loss. Rollback is a straight version pin revert. The tuning constants applied in this upgrade are listed below.

tuning constants:
QUOTAS = {
    "druwyn": 5,
    "holix": 5,
    "zorath": 5,
    "holwyn": 10,
}